How much does it cost to rent a home in Mapelton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Mapelton 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,443 | $900 | $2,500 |
| Mapelton 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,504 | $1,000 | $2,300 |
| Mapelton 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,735 | $1,395 | $2,445 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Mapelton
What type of rentals are currently available in Mapelton?
There are currently 144 Apartments for Rent in Mapelton, IN with pricing that ranges from $629 to $5,150. There are also 58 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Mapelton ranging from $750 to $2,600.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Mapelton?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Mapelton ranges from $750 to $2,600 with an average monthly rent of $1,421.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Mapelton?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Mapelton range from $1,249 to $4,272,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,000 to $2,300.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,395 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$995.
